Part Time Kayak Tour Guide information

What is a part time kayak tour guide?

Part time kayak tour guides are individuals who lead groups on kayaking excursions, typically on a seasonal or flexible schedule. Their responsibilities include ensuring the safety of guests, providing instruction on paddling techniques, sharing information about the local environment or wildlife, and creating an enjoyable experience for participants. These guides often work for outdoor adventure companies, parks, or resorts, and may need certifications in first aid or water safety. The role is ideal for those who enjoy outdoor activities, have strong communication skills, and can manage group dynamics on the water.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time kayak tour guide?

To thrive as a Part Time Kayak Tour Guide, you need strong paddling skills, knowledge of local waterways, basic first aid certification, and experience in outdoor recreation. Familiarity with kayak safety gear, navigation tools, and group communication devices is typically required. Exceptional interpersonal skills, enthusiasm, and the ability to manage groups safely in a dynamic environment make a guide stand out. These abilities ensure guests have a safe, informative, and enjoyable experience, which is crucial for customer satisfaction and safety.

What are some common challenges faced by part time kayak tour guides, and how can they be managed?

Part-time kayak tour guides often face challenges such as adapting to varying weather conditions, ensuring guest safety on the water, and managing groups with different skill levels. To handle these, guides should stay updated on weather forecasts, conduct thorough safety briefings, and use clear communication to foster teamwork among participants. Regularly practicing rescue techniques and honing interpersonal skills can also help guides create enjoyable and safe experiences for all guests.
